The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) has launched a new website with information on sepsis prevention and care. Created to improve early recognition, diagnosis, and treatment of the complication, the website's information is broken down into six sections: basic information (fact sheets and questions and answers for patients,), clinical guidelines and tools (guidelines, bundles, education resources, and tools), improving survival (quality improvement efforts by healthcare facilities to improve survival in sepsis), medical bibliography (selected sepsis chapters from medical textbooks), data reports (recent reports on the incidence of sepsis), and related links to additional information about sepsis.
